| Overview |
| Name | Oxygen |
| Symbol | O |
| Atomic Number | 8 |
| Atomic Weight | 15.9994 |
| Density | 1.429 g/l[note] |
| Melting Point | -218.3 °C |
| Boiling Point | -182.9 °C |
Thermal properties |
| Phase | Gas |
| Melting Point | -218.3 °C |
| Boiling Point | -182.9 °C |
| Absolute Melting Point | 54.8 K |
| Absolute Boiling Point | 90.2 K |
| Critical Presure | 5.043 MPa (49.77 Atm) |
| Critical Temperature | 154.59 K |
| Heat of Fusion | 0.222 kJ/mol |
| Heat of Vaporization | 3.41 kJ/mol |
| Heat of Combustion | N/A |
| Specific Heat | 919 J/(kg K)[note] |
| Adiabatic Index | 7/5 |
| Thermal Conductivity | 0.02658 W/(m K) |
| Thermal Expansion | N/A |
Bulk physical properties |
| Density | 1.429 g/l[note] |
| Density (Liquid) | N/A |
| Molar Volume | 0.011196 |
| Refractive Index | 1.000271 |
| Speed of Sound | 317.5 m/s |
| Thermal Conductivity | 0.02658 W/(m K) |
| Thermal Expansion | N/A |
Reactivity |
| Valence | 2 |
| Electronegativity | 3.44 |
| ElectronAffinity | 141 kJ/mol |
| Ionization Energies | | 1313.9, 3388.3, 5300.5, 7469.2, 10989.5, 13326.5, 71330, 84078 kJ/mol |

Classifications |
| Alternate Names | None |
| Nams of Allotropes | | Dioxygen, Ozone, Tetraoxygen |
|
| Block | p |
| Group | 16 |
| Period | 2 |
| Electron Configuration | [He]2s22p4 |
| Color | Colorless |
| Discovery | | 1774 in Sweden and United Kingdom |
|
| Gas phase | Diatomic |
| CAS Number | CAS7782-44-7 |

Magnetic properties |
| Magnetic Type | Paramagnetic |
| Curie Point | N/A |
| Mass Magnetic Susceptibility | 1.335×10-6 |
| Molar Magnetic Susceptibility | 2.13592×10-8 |
| Volume Magnetic Susceptibility | 1.90772×10-6 |
Abundances |
| % in Universe | 1% |
| % in Sun | 0.9% |
| % in Meteorites | 40% |
| % in Earth's Crust | 46% |
| % in Oceans | 86% |
| % in Humans | 61% |
Atomic dimensions and structure |
| Atomic Radius | 48 pm |
| Covalent Radius | 73 pm |
| Van der Waals Radius | 152 pm |
| Crystal Structure | Base Centered Monoclinic |
| Lattice Angles | |
| Lattice Constants | |
| Space Group Name | C12/m1 |
| Space Group Number | 12 |
Nuclear Properties |
| Half-Life | Stable |
| Lifetime | Stable |
| Stable Isotopes | |
| Isotopic Abundances | | 16O | 99.757% | | 17O | 0.038% | | 18O | 0.205% |
